Transaction a129c96f774540902e062cdda7e534cdaaeabcd14bc6a393017f11aaf0e3aa7e
1 Input
1 Output
-
a129c96f774540902e062cdda7e534cdaaeabcd14bc6a393017f11aaf0e3aa7e:0
- value
- 531748
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9fa3752f93617c02247f1b52887a286a1259e428 OP_EQUAL
- address
- 3GF7BHhzyZHQ4oFXKmx8sQPMqwsgUDfnQZ